CURRENTLY UNDER CONTRACT plus PRICE REDUCTION ANNOUNCED (Back-up offers are very much welcomed by the vendors) Step into a genuine piece of Northland history with this beautifully restored Old Stationmaster's Homestead - a spacious 4-bedroom, 146sqm character residence set on a generous 2,428sqm (over half-acre) section in the off-the-beaten-track valley setting of the peaceful Donnellys Crossing village. Originally built circa 1915-1920, this elegant home served for decades as the residence of the Stationmasters along the Kaihu Valley railway line. While the trains have long since ceased, the home remains a proud reminder of the region's golden era of quality timber construction and the transporting of milled Waipoua kauri. Outside, the generous grounds offer space for gardens, pets, or simply unwinding beneath mature trees, surrounded by native bush and rural outlooks, with the Waima River forming a natural boundary. (For clarity, the property is not identified on Northland Regional Council flood maps. The home is positioned elevated above the river level.) Adding further versatility, there is a separate approx 55sqm (7.8m x 7.0m) enclosed Workshop with multiple potential uses, along with a 6.3m x 2.5m old shed for hobbies or additional storage. Donnellys Crossing itself is a small, friendly Northland community near the gateway to the Waipoua Forest, home of Tane Mahuta. The area offers a tranquil rural lifestyle, surrounded by farmland and native bush, yet within reach of west coast beaches and key regional centres. Skilled Migrant Category Resident Visa — points-based system requiring a skilled job offer in NZ. New pathways opening August 2026 for trades workers and those with 5+ years experience. Accredited Employer Work Visa is the faster route if you already have a job offer.

NZ has strict biosecurity laws — importing food, plants, or outdoor gear can result in heavy fines. The work-life balance is exceptional, but the job market is small and remote from everywhere.

Foreign Buyer Note
Foreign buyers BANNED from existing homes (2018 ban). Can only buy new-build apartments in large developments.
